Where Is In-N-Out Burger Located?

According to In-N-Out’s Location Guide—which lists every restaurant location for In-N-Out lovers who want to visit each special spot—the chain is currently located in seven states.

The guide further lists a total of 378 In-N-Out locations nationwide, with the overwhelming majority of those residing throughout California. Although many Arizona, Texas, Utah, Oregon, Colorado and Nevada residents can still indulge in some signature In-N-Out sauce.

Why Won’t In-N-Out Burger Open on the East Coast?

It turns out, there are actually a few reasons that In-N-Out hasn’t expanded far from the Pacific. But why? It has to do with frozen hamburger patties.

The In-N-Out website explains that they “don’t freeze, pre-package or microwave” its food. They commit to “make things the old-fashioned way.” Essentially, its hamburger patties are only made with the highest-quality, fresh meat.

To ensure quality even further, In-N-out solely opens restaurant locations within 300 miles of its three very own patty-making facilities. The 100% USDA ground chunk patties “free of additives, fillers and preservatives” are made at the chain’s Baldwin Park, California, Lathrop, California and Dallas, Texas facilities.

The website states that even its lettuce, American cheese, onions, tomatoes, buns and fries are all fresh! Talk about healthy fast-food orders.

To deflate any hopes of a possible East Coast In-N-Out, the company’s president—Lynsi Snyder “has said the company will never go public or franchise its restaurants,” according to Business Insider.

Where Can You Find In-N-Out Burger Locations?

Fortunately, In-N-Out continues to open new locations! Its latest will soon open as the first location in Denver, Colorado. The opening date has not been officially released yet, but it has been speculated that it could take place early in 2023.

In 2020, the first two Colorado locations of the franchise opened. With the introduction of its new Denver location, the state will now have five In-N-Out restaurants.
